    Stimulants

    Stimulants stimulate the nervous system among other systems. They are prescribed drugs that treat att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(online adhd treatment), narcolepsy, and obesity. They can also be used as recreational drugs to increase energy and concentration. They can be injected, snorted or taken orally. They are classified as Schedule II substances under the Controlled Substances Act, meaning they have a high chance of misuse.

    Amphetamines, along with the methylphenidate are two of the most commonly used stimulant drugs. Amphetamines increase alertness, awareness and productivity by increasing the levels of chemical in your brain called dopamine and norepinephrine. They can help people suffering from ADHD feel less tired and boost their concentration.     The effects of stimulants aren't just addictive but could be harmful to those suffering from certain health conditions. These medications can raise blood pressure and heart rate, which can cause heart attacks or strokes. They can also trigger seizures, among other mental health issues.

    Many people with ADHD see a positive improvement in their symptoms only several weeks after beginning stimulant medication. However, it can take longer for some people to notice improvements. These improvements are usually evident to family members or friends, teachers, and work colleagues.

    The addiction to stimulants can occur when people take them in higher doses or for longer durations than prescribed by their health care providers. It may also occur when stimulants are combined with other substances, such as opioids. This can result in an extremely dangerous combination which increases the risk of overdose and death.

    The use of prescription stimulants can lead to addiction however, they are less likely to cause addiction than illicit substances like cocaine and methamphetamines. Any drug used incorrectly can cause addiction and dependence.
